About the Senior Front-End Software Engineer, Sportsbook role

Pursue a career at the forefront of digital innovation with Senior Front-End Software Engineer, Sportsbook jobs. This specialized role sits at the exciting intersection of cutting-edge software engineering and the dynamic world of online sports betting and gaming. Professionals in this field are responsible for building the high-performance, engaging, and visually compelling user interfaces that millions of customers interact with daily. They translate complex betting logic, real-time data feeds, and intricate design systems into seamless, accessible, and secure web applications.

A Senior Front-End Software Engineer in the sportsbook domain typically shoulders a wide array of critical responsibilities. Their core duty is hands-on development, writing clean, efficient, and maintainable code using modern JavaScript frameworks like React, Vue, or Svelte, often within meta-frameworks such as Next.js or Nuxt for server-side rendering. They architect scalable front-end solutions, ensuring optimal performance and responsiveness across all devices. A key part of the role involves integrating with backend services via GraphQL or RESTful APIs and managing real-time data streams through WebSockets to display live odds, scores, and updates instantaneously. They rigorously test and debug applications, advocate for best practices in code quality, and contribute to design system components using tools like Storybook. Beyond coding, senior engineers lead technical discussions, mentor junior team members, and collaborate closely with product managers, UX/UI designers, and backend engineers to translate business requirements into technical execution.

The typical skill set for these jobs is both deep and broad. Employers generally seek candidates with substantial professional experience in front-end development, backed by a strong foundation in computer science principles or equivalent practical expertise. Proficiency in TypeScript is increasingly standard, ensuring type safety in complex applications. A solid understanding of state management, responsive design, web performance optimization, and accessibility (a11y) guidelines is essential. Given the industry context, skills in handling real-time data, understanding of compliance considerations,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, regulated environment are highly valued. Soft skills are equally important; successful senior engineers demonstrate excellent problem-solving abilities, clear communication for cross-functional collaboration, and a proactive mindset for driving innovation and process improvements.
